Asexuality 🤝🏾 s3x-positivity! As an asexual activist, it's such a nice surprise to be nominated for the S3x-Positive Influencer Award at the #SNAPawards2026! If you want, you can click the link in my bio to vote for me (it just takes a tap and you can do it more than once). 👀
It is often (wrongly) assumed that if you're asexual, you probably have s3x-negative attitudes, which really isn't the case and often leads to asexuality and asexual people being left out of important conversations. Asexuality and s3x-positivity do not exist in contradiction, and that's something I've always tried to highlight in my work. Thanks for recognising that! 💜

New research finds that asexual respondents report sharper declines in acceptance than other LGBTQ+ groups - Human Rights Campaign
For the first time, the Human Rights Campaign has partnered with British multi-award-winning asexual activist and researcher, Yasmin Benoit, on a new report highlighting the impact the cultural climate is having on the asexual community in particular. Their data finds that asexual respondents reported sharper declines in their acceptance, outness and visibility - and also the nuances in what those who just identified as asexual are experiencing, compared to those with different romantic orientations and gender-diverse identities.
As one of the biggest LGBTQ+ organisations in the US, the collaboration is testament to the growing recognition of the asexual community’s needs. Yasmin Benoit has said that she is “honoured” to be partnering with the HRC on this new research. “There is still debate about asexual inclusion in LGBTQ+ spaces, so it’s amazing to see such an influential organization get behind the asexual community in a time when we need the support the most.”

April 6 marks International Asexuality Day.
According to the HRC Foundation’s 2025 Annual LGBTQ+ Community Survey, our asexual community is experiencing sharper declines in acceptance, outness, and visibility — more than LGBTQIA+ adults overall.
